0

JSON を出力しましたが、ページネーション情報がありませんか?

表示したい枚数の写真があるのでページネーションを探しているのですが、欲しい枚数が表示されません。

これは私のコントローラーにあります:

client = Instagram.client(:access_token => session[:access_token])
@user = client.user
@recent_media_items = client.user_recent_media

@tag_media_items = client.tag_recent_media('cat', options = {:count => 60})

@location_media_items = client.location_recent_media('12345', options = {:count => 60})

私の見解では、これがあります:

<% (@tag_media_items+@location_media_items).sort{|a,b| -(a.created_time <=> b.created_time)}.each do |media| %>
    <span>
    <img src="<%= media.images.thumbnail.url %>">
    </span>
<% end %>

これにより、これら 2 つのメディアが配列に入れられ、created_time で並べ替えられます。しかし、それが出力されると、120 ではなく、合計 42 の画像しか取得できません。Instagram を調べたところ、画像はテストした検索と一致しましたが、さらに多くの画像が含まれています。

私が見ることができないページネーションの追加画像ですか?

ありがとう

4

1 に答える 1

1

Instagram API はまだメディア検索 (地理) クエリのページネーションを提供していないと思います。

https://groups.google.com/forum/?fromgroups=#!topic/instagram-api-developers/aLanTqk3LnY

https://groups.google.com/forum/?fromgroups=#!searchin/instagram-api-developers/pagination/instagram-api-developers/qY_dqCPj-k8/y4u7y4sF1GQJ

:(

于 2013-04-25T00:34:44.550 に答える